The AD200b is a nice simple powerful tube amp. Warm, with a lot of bite if you want it.
Personally, I think tubes are much more of a 6 string guitar necessity. Whilst they always sound great, I think they are more crucial to a guitar sound. A good quality solid state bass amp of say 500W with a high end gain pedal and you will get so close with a lot more headroom.
Unless I toured with a band properly again, I wouldn't opt for a full tube amp for bass.
I do however think the Orange solid state amps are worth your time. If they still made it, I would suggest the Bass Terror!
